Petitioners have filed this petition under Section 438 of the Code of Criminal Procedure, 1973 seeking anticipatory bail in FIR No. 68 dated 23.6.2015 under Section 323, 452, 506, 148, 149 of the Indian Penal Code, 1860, registered at Police Station Bullowal, Hoshiarpur.
While issuing notice of motion, following order was passed by this Court on 16.7.2015:- "It is inter alia contended that the only non-bailable offence is under Section 452 IPC. It is further contended that two of the co-accused who are females have been extended the concession of pre-arrest bail. It is also contended that cause of dispute was that Preeti one of the co-accused had a suspicion that her husband, namely; Raj Pal had illicit affair with Seema daughter of complainant- Ram Kishan.
Notice of motion for 24.09.2015.

Crl. Misc. No. M- 22842 of 2015 -2- Meanwhile, in the event of arrest of the petitioners, they shall be released on bail by the Arresting/Investigating Officer. The petitioners shall abide by the conditions as enshrined in Section 438 (2) Cr.P.C. "
Learned State counsel, who is assisted by Head Constable Sukhdev Singh, has submitted that in terms of the above order, petitioners have joined investigation and are not required for further investigation.
Accordingly, interim bail granted by this Court to the petitioners vide order dated 16.7.2015, is made absolute. Petition stands disposed of accordingly.
